so wait... there's good cholesterol?! by syanxde in ArcherFX

[–]mcleanatg 34 points35 points  (0 children)

For those curious, “good cholesterol” is high density lipoprotein (HDL) while bad cholesterol is low density lipoprotein (LDL). Ideally you want your LDL under 100 mg/dL and your HDL at least 60 mg/dL
